Shleshmataka – Cordia dichotoma is an Ayurvedic plant, used for the treatment of cough, asthma, skin diseases, fever, diarrhea, intestinal worms and wounds. Latin name- Cordia dichotoma Forst. Family- Boraginaceae Names in different languages: Hindi name- Lasoda, Dela, Tenti, Gunda English name- Sebesten, Glue berry, Pink pearl tree, Bird Lime tree, Fragrant manjack, snotty gobbles, glue […]
